4-Isothiocyanato-4′-nitrodiphenylamine (C9333-Go/CGP 4540) an anthelminthic with an unusual spectrum of activity against intestinal nematodes, filariae and schistosomes

Abstract
4-isothiocyanato-4′-nitrodiphenylamine was found to possess activity against intestinal nematodes in mice, against schistosomes in various hosts including primates and against two filarial species in the mongolian jird. Upon administration in a single oral dose it is equally effective againstS. haematobium, S. mansoni andS. japonicum.Keywords
